to be honest with you hitman, im about to do the same with my old LG longtubes from my 02Z on my 06 Coupe. I was told that the headers would bolt directly up to the heads and the only areas of concern would be the primaries being close to the oil pan. Also the mounting locations near the merge collectors are vertical on the C6 instead of horizontal like on the C5. Other than that just hack off the flange on the rear X-Pipe and it should fit up to the stock C6 exhaust. Theres no way the C5 cat back exhaust will fit due to muffler locations.
The LS2 heads are the same castings as the C5 ZO6 so they will bolt up.You wont need the air tubes if your LG's have them. Iam curious to hear how they fit, please reply to this thread when you try it.
A couple things I found that do swap over, the front and rear sway bars and the aftermarket tunnel plates.
